NBA Expected To Investigate Joel Embiid Injury Report

The NBA is expected to investigate Joel Embiid’s return to the Philadelphia 76ers’ lineup on Tuesday night.

“I’ve spoken to multiple people inside the NBA league office, and we should expect some sort of investigation into how the Sixers handled the injury report, going from out, out, out, to questionable, to playing in a short span of time.

“The league office will certainly take note of that,” said Jared Greenberg on NBA on TNT.

Embiid, who returned after eight weeks following a procedure on his knee, finished the game with 24 points and 6 rebounds.

The Sixers are 27-8 with Embiid in the lineup.

Raptors Pick Up $23M Option On Bruce Brown, Will Continue To Evaluate Trade OptionsRaptors Pick Up $23M Option On Bruce Brown, Will Continue To Evaluate Trade Options

The Toronto Raptors have decided to pick up their $23 million option on Bruce Brown. The Raptors will continue to explore possible trades involving Brown this offseason.

The Raptors acquired Brown from the Indiana Pacers as part of the Pascal Siakam trade. Brown signed a two-year, $45 million deal with the Pacers during the 2023 offseason following his excellent performance in the playoffs for the Denver Nuggets.

In 34 games last season with the Raptors, Brown averaged 9.7 points, 3.8 rebounds and 2.7 assists in 26.0 minutes.

Brown is represented by Ty Sullivan of CAA.
